Police Arrest Youth and Juvenile in Mobile Snatching Case

Published on: April 3, 2025
By: [BTI]
Location: Rajnandgaon, India

Accused Snatched Mobile from a Young Woman in Rajnandgaon

Rajnandgaon – In a swift action, Basantpur police arrested a youth and a juvenile involved in a mobile snatching case near Gauravpath Road. The accused, riding a black Activa scooter, snatched a Vivo smartphone from the hands of a young woman and fled the scene. The incident took place on April 2, 2025, at approximately 8:30 AM.

Incident Details

According to the complaint filed by the victim, she was walking with a friend after attending her coaching class when two unidentified individuals approached her on a black Activa scooter (CG-08-NA-9289). As they neared Urja Park, the pillion rider swiftly snatched the mobile phone from her hand and sped away.

Following the complaint, Basantpur Police Station registered a case under IPC Section 304 and initiated an investigation.

Swift Police Action

Taking the matter seriously, Superintendent of Police Mohit Garg (IPS) instructed his team to identify and apprehend the culprits. Under the guidance of Additional Superintendent of Police Rahul Dev Sharma and City Superintendent of Police Pushpendra Nayak, a special team was formed, led by Station House Officer (SHO) Eman Sahu.

The police team:

  • Reviewed CCTV footage from the crime scene and surrounding areas.
  • Identified suspects based on surveillance footage.
  • Apprehended two individuals after tracing their movements.

Arrest and Seizure

The accused were identified as Manish Patel (19 years), son of Rohit Patel, a resident of Birejhar village, and a juvenile in conflict with the law. Upon interrogation, both confessed to the crime.

Items Recovered:

  • One Vivo smartphone snatched from the victim.
  • Black Activa scooter (CG-08-NA-9289) used in the crime.

Both accused were presented before the honorable court, where Manish Patel was remanded to Rajnandgaon District Jail, while the juvenile was sent to a correctional facility.

Accused’s Criminal History

Manish Patel has a criminal background, with multiple cases registered against him at Somni Police Station:

  • Case No. 196/2023 – Sections 294, 323, 506, 34 IPC.
  • Case No. 204/2024 – Sections 331(4), 305 BNS.
